Beeline Holdings Charts Aggressive Revenue Target with Strategic Hire

In a strategic pivot, digital mortgage financier Beeline Holdings is shifting its focus from cost containment to ambitious growth. The company has set a clear objective: to achieve a $100 million annual revenue run rate within the next two years. Central to this plan is the recent appointment of banking veteran Barry Levenson as a strategic advisor.

A Veteran Advisor for a Critical Phase

Beeline officially announced the engagement of Barry Levenson yesterday. He brings more than three decades of sector expertise, including leadership roles at PennyMac Financial Services and as a founding member of Countrywide Bank. His most recent position was CEO of LK Secured Lending. In his new advisory capacity, Levenson will be tasked with refining the company’s capital strategy and enhancing its loan economics to improve refinancing efficiency.

This appointment signals a definitive change in corporate direction. Following a period dedicated to reducing expenditures and curbing losses, management is now prioritizing expansion. CEO Nick Liuzza cited a more stable market environment as the rationale for increased marketing investments aimed at stimulating new business.

Market Reaction and Analyst Stance

The market’s initial response to the announcement was muted. Shares closed yesterday’s session with a slight decline of 0.35 percent at $2.84, giving the company a current market valuation of approximately $76 million. Presently, analysts cover the stock with a “Hold” recommendation and maintain a price target of $3.50.

The effectiveness of the newly emphasized marketing initiatives will be tested over the coming quarters. The immediate focus for Beeline is leveraging Levenson’s guidance to boost funding efficiency, a critical component for reaching the stated $100 million revenue milestone on schedule.

The next 24 months will prove decisive in determining whether this strategic shift and the infusion of industry experience can deliver the necessary momentum for Beeline to realize its substantial growth ambitions.
